Harmonic 3Q Profit Falls 78 Percent On Lower Sales
Stock quotes in this article:
HLIT
SUNNYVALE, Calif. (AP) — Harmonic Inc., a provider of broadcast and video delivery systems, released third-quarter results on Wednesday that showed a 78 percent profit decline as customers continued to be cautious with their spending.
The stock plummeted in aftermarket trading. The company, based in Sunnyvale, Calif., earned $2.6 million, or 3 cents per share, in the quarter that ended Oct. 2. That is down from the $12 million, or 12 cents per share, it earned a year earlier. Adjusted profit of 5 cents per share fell short of a 6 cent per share consensus prediction of analysts polled by Thomson Reuters. Revenue fell 8 percent to $83.9 million from $91.5 million. Analysts had expected $85.8 million.
